Abstract

We present a measurement of the lower-branch exciton-polariton occupation in room-temperature J-aggregate microcavity devices under low-density steady-state excitation. The observed occupation follows a Maxwell-Boltzmann distribution at T=300K, indicating efficient polariton relaxation, necessary for achieving lasing.
